Lassy,
the switches on the elcer nuo5, above the bass FX send/return and below the PFL buttons, what kind are they? DO they slide back and forth on the horizontal plane or do they pivot around a joint. See diagram below:
Are they easy to switch on the fly?
Picture B: Pivot around a joint. Easy enough to switch on the fly.
The ones above (right hand side on my pic) are the bass kill switches, the ones below (left) are the switches for assigning the channels to the x-fader.

here are the pics of the stands i made for my rp8. cost me 5 bucks in wood and 10 bucks in spray paint. quick, cheap, and easy to make.
pretty much consists of two 2"x4" i cut i nto 44" pieces. the top is a 11"x12" platform for the monitor and the bottom is a 16"x16" base.
im happy with how they came out heh. going to go buy some mopads tomorrow and it'll be all done!! whatta you guys think?
